IMG-LOGO
Trang chủ Lớp 12 Tin học Trắc nghiệm Tin học 12 Chân trời sáng tạo Bài F5: Tạo biểu mẫu trong trang web

Trắc nghiệm Tin học 12 Chân trời sáng tạo Bài F5: Tạo biểu mẫu trong trang web

Trắc nghiệm Tin học 12 Chân trời sáng tạo Bài F5: Tạo biểu mẫu trong trang web

  • 24 lượt thi

  • 15 câu hỏi

  • 45 phút

Danh sách câu hỏi

Câu 1:

PHẦN I. Câu trắc nghiệm nhiều phương án lựa chọn. Thí sinh trả lời từ câu 1 đến câu 10. Mỗi câu hỏi thí sinh chỉ lựa chọn một phương án.

Biểu mẫu web giúp người dùng làm gì?

Xem đáp án

Đáp án: A

Giải thích: Biểu mẫu web là một phương tiện để người dùng nhập và gửi dữ liệu đến máy chủ. Nó cho phép người dùng tương tác với trang web thông qua các thao tác như nhập dữ liệu văn bản, chọn phương án, và nháy chuột vào nút nhấn.


Câu 2:

Thuộc tính action trong thẻ <form> có tác dụng gì?
Xem đáp án

Đáp án: B

Giải thích: Thuộc tính action trong thẻ <form> chỉ định URL của trang web hoặc kịch bản nơi dữ liệu biểu mẫu sẽ được gửi để xử lý.


Câu 3:

Phương thức gửi dữ liệu GET có đặc điểm gì?

Xem đáp án

Đáp án: C

Giải thích: Phương thức GET gửi dữ liệu bằng cách đính kèm nó vào URL, khiến dữ liệu hiển thị trên thanh địa chỉ của trình duyệt.


Câu 4:

Phương thức gửi dữ liệu POST có đặc điểm gì?
Xem đáp án

Đáp án: C

Giải thích: Phương thức POST gửi dữ liệu dưới dạng gói tin trực tiếp đến trang nhận dữ liệu và không hiển thị trên thanh địa chỉ của trình duyệt, giúp bảo mật dữ liệu hơn.


Câu 5:

Nếu không chỉ định thuộc tính method trong thẻ <form>, phương thức gửi dữ liệu mặc định sẽ là gì?
Xem đáp án

Đáp án: B

Giải thích: Nếu không chỉ định thuộc tính method trong thẻ <form>, dữ liệu sẽ được gửi bằng phương thức GET theo mặc định.


Câu 6:

Để tạo ô nhập liệu văn bản trong biểu mẫu, chúng ta sử dụng thẻ nào?
Xem đáp án

Đáp án: B

Giải thích: Thẻ <input> với thuộc tính type="text" được sử dụng để tạo ô nhập liệu văn bản trong biểu mẫu.


Câu 7:

Thẻ <textarea> thường được sử dụng để làm gì trong biểu mẫu?
Xem đáp án

 Đáp án: B

Giải thích: Thẻ <textarea> tạo ra một vùng nhập liệu văn bản đa dòng, thường được sử dụng khi cần nhập văn bản dài hơn.


Câu 8:

Thuộc tính type="radio" của thẻ <input> tạo ra loại thành phần nào trong biểu mẫu?
Xem đáp án

Đáp án: A

Giải thích: Thuộc tính type="radio" tạo ra nút chọn một, cho phép người dùng chọn một trong số nhiều tùy chọn.


Câu 9:

Để tạo nút gửi dữ liệu trong biểu mẫu, chúng ta sử dụng thẻ nào?
Xem đáp án

Đáp án: D

Giải thích: Cả thẻ <button> và thẻ <input type="submit"> đều có thể được sử dụng để tạo nút gửi dữ liệu trong biểu mẫu.


Câu 10:

Nếu thuộc tính action không được chỉ định trong thẻ <form>, dữ liệu sẽ được gửi đến đâu?

Xem đáp án

Đáp án: C

Giải thích: Nếu không chỉ định thuộc tính action, dữ liệu sẽ được gửi đến trang hiện tại theo mặc định.


Câu 11:

PHẦN II. Câu trắc nghiệm đúng Sai. Thí sinh trả lời từ câu 1 đến câu 2. Trong mỗi ý a), b), c), d) ở mỗi câu, thí sinh chọn đúng hoặc sai

Phát biểu sau đây đúng hay sai về biểu mẫu web ?

a) Biểu mẫu web chỉ cho phép nhập liệu văn bản.

b) Biểu mẫu web giúp người dùng tương tác với trang web.

c) Chỉ có một cách để gửi dữ liệu từ biểu mẫu web.

d) Biểu mẫu web không thể chứa nút nhấn.

Xem đáp án

a) Sai: Biểu mẫu web cho phép nhập liệu nhiều dạng dữ liệu khác nhau như văn bản, số, email, mật khẩu, và chọn các phương án.

b) Đúng: Biểu mẫu web là một công cụ để người dùng gửi dữ liệu và yêu cầu đến trang web, từ đó trang web có thể phản hồi lại.

c) Sai: Có hai phương thức chính để gửi dữ liệu từ biểu mẫu web: GET và POST.

d) Sai: Biểu mẫu web có thể chứa các nút nhấn (button) để người dùng gửi dữ liệu hoặc thực hiện các hành động khác.


Câu 12:

Phát biểu sau đây đúng hay sai về thuộc tính của thẻ <form> trong biểu mẫu web?

a) Thuộc tính action của thẻ <form> chỉ định địa chỉ trang nhận dữ liệu.

b) Thuộc tính method mặc định là POST nếu không được chỉ định.

c) Dữ liệu gửi bằng phương thức GET sẽ không hiển thị trên thanh địa chỉ của trình duyệt.

d) Thẻ <input> không thể tạo ra các trường nhập liệu dạng radio hoặc checkbox.

Xem đáp án

a) Đúng: Thuộc tính action xác định URL mà dữ liệu sẽ được gửi đến để xử lý.

b) Sai: Thuộc tính method mặc định là GET nếu không được chỉ định.

c) Sai: Dữ liệu gửi bằng phương thức GET sẽ được gắn vào URL và hiển thị trên thanh địa chỉ của trình duyệt.

d) Sai: Thẻ <input> có thể tạo ra các trường nhập liệu dạng radio, checkbox và nhiều loại khác thông qua thuộc tính type.


Câu 13:

PHẦN III. Câu trả lời ngắn. Thí sinh trả lời từ câu 1 đến câu 3

Biểu mẫu web là gì và có những cách thức nào để người dùng tương tác với nó?

Xem đáp án

Đáp án: Biểu mẫu web là một thành phần cho phép người dùng nhập dữ liệu vào trang web. Người dùng có thể tương tác với biểu mẫu thông qua nhiều cách thức như nhập dữ liệu văn bản, số, email, mật khẩu hoặc chọn các phương án và nháy chuột vào nút nhấn.

Giải thích: Biểu mẫu web đóng vai trò là cầu nối giữa người dùng và trang web, cho phép thu thập thông tin từ người dùng để xử lý. Các thao tác tương tác đa dạng giúp người dùng gửi thông tin cần thiết một cách linh hoạt.


Câu 14:

Hai phương thức chính để gửi dữ liệu từ biểu mẫu web là gì và chúng hoạt động như thế nào?
Xem đáp án

Đáp án: Hai phương thức chính để gửi dữ liệu từ biểu mẫu web là GET và POST. GET gắn dữ liệu vào URL và hiển thị trên thanh địa chỉ, còn POST gửi dữ liệu dưới dạng gói tin.

Giải thích: Phương thức GET dễ bị giới hạn bởi kích thước URL và không an toàn cho dữ liệu nhạy cảm vì hiển thị trên thanh địa chỉ. Trong khi đó, phương thức POST không hiển thị dữ liệu trên URL, phù hợp cho việc gửi dữ liệu lớn hoặc nhạy cảm.


Câu 15:

Nếu không chỉ định thuộc tính method trong thẻ <form>, dữ liệu sẽ được gửi bằng phương thức nào? Giải thích?
Xem đáp án

Đáp án: Nếu không chỉ định thuộc tính method, dữ liệu sẽ được gửi mặc định bằng phương thức GET.

Giải thích: Phương thức GET là mặc định trong HTML nếu không có phương thức nào được chỉ định. Điều này có nghĩa là dữ liệu sẽ được gắn vào URL và hiển thị trên thanh địa chỉ, thích hợp cho các yêu cầu không nhạy cảm và truy vấn dữ liệu.


Bắt đầu thi ngay